Unlock Your Nursing Career: The Ultimate Guide to the UNLV BSN Program

Embarking on a Bachelor of Science in Nursing (BSN) is a significant decision, and choosing the right program is paramount for your future career. The UNLV BSN program stands out as a premier option for aspiring nurses in the Las Vegas metropolitan area, offering a rigorous curriculum designed to meet the evolving demands of the healthcare industry. This pathway is tailored for individuals committed to patient care, evidence-based practice, and leadership within the nursing profession.

Accreditation and Academic Excellence

The foundation of the UNLV BSN program rests on a solid base of accreditation and academic standards. The curriculum is meticulously crafted to align with the latest guidelines from the American Association of Colleges of Nursing (AACN). This ensures that graduates are not only knowledgeable but also possess the critical thinking and clinical reasoning skills required to excel in diverse healthcare settings. The program’s structure emphasizes both theoretical knowledge and practical application, bridging the gap between classroom learning and real-world patient interaction.

Comprehensive Curriculum and Specializations

Students progress through a sequence of courses that build upon one another, creating a comprehensive understanding of the nursing field. The early coursework focuses on foundational sciences and nursing theory, while later semesters delve into complex health scenarios and specialized care. The program offers distinct tracks that allow students to tailor their education toward specific interests, such as community health or leadership, preparing them for targeted roles within the hospital or community sectors.

Clinical Rotations and Hands-On Experience

Practical experience is the cornerstone of the UNLV BSN program. Students engage in extensive clinical rotations across a variety of healthcare facilities in the Las Vegas area, including hospitals, clinics, and community health centers. These rotations provide invaluable opportunities to work alongside experienced professionals, apply theoretical knowledge in real-time, and develop the confidence necessary to transition smoothly from student to practicing nurse. The partnerships with local medical institutions ensure that training is current and relevant to the contemporary healthcare landscape.

Admission Requirements and Application Process

Admission to the program is competitive and requires careful preparation. Prospective students must meet specific prerequisite coursework requirements, maintain a competitive GPA, and submit a compelling application that demonstrates their passion for nursing. The selection process typically includes a review of academic transcripts, prerequisite completion, and often an entrance exam or interview. Understanding these criteria early allows applicants to present the strongest possible candidacy for this esteemed program.

Support Services and Student Resources

Success in the program is supported by a robust network of resources designed to foster student growth. Academic advising, tutoring centers, and peer mentorship programs are readily available to help navigate the challenges of the rigorous curriculum. Additionally, the university provides state-of-the-art simulation labs where students can practice clinical skills in a risk-free environment, ensuring they are well-prepared before setting foot in a real clinical setting.

Career Outcomes and Program Reputation

Graduates of the UNLV BSN program are highly sought after by healthcare employers across Nevada and the nation. The program’s reputation for producing competent, compassionate, and ready-to-practice nurses opens doors to a variety of career paths in acute care, public health, and research. The strong alumni network and active recruitment events facilitate job placement, making this program a strategic investment in a stable and rewarding professional future.
